Overlooking the Surrounding Atmosphere



When choosing outside paint colors, several businesses forget the relevance of their surrounding environment, which can result in dissimilar visual appeals and lost opportunities. You could find a vibrant hue appealing alone, however if it encounter nearby frameworks or the all-natural landscape, it can create an inhospitable environment.

Think about the architectural design of bordering buildings and the total ambiance of your area. If you remain in a coastal neighborhood, soft blues and sandy off-whites could reverberate better than vibrant reds or deep environment-friendlies. Similarly, metropolitan settings often favor streamlined, modern-day schemes that straighten with the surrounding infrastructure.

Require time to assess the colors controling your neighborhood. This does not mean you can't reveal your brand's individuality, yet it needs to balance with its setting. You wish to bring in consumers, not repel them with jarring contrasts.

Integrating aspects like local flora can likewise improve your design, producing a seamless transition in between your service and its environments.

Overlooking Shade Psychology



Disregarding the bordering setting can bring about mismatched looks, but that's just one part of the equation. You can not neglect shade psychology when picking outside paint shades for your service. Colors stimulate emotions and can significantly affect how possible customers perceive your brand name. For example, blue typically conveys trust and professionalism and trust, while red can stir up passion and urgency.

Consider your target audience and the sensations you intend to evoke. If your business is family-oriented, warm colors like yellows and oranges can develop an inviting ambience. Conversely, if you're aiming for a streamlined, modern ambiance, great tones like grey or navy may be better.

Do not forget that shades can likewise impact presence and attract attention. Brighter colors can stand out in a jampacked setting, making your business a lot more visible. Nevertheless, select intelligently; overly intense colors might overwhelm or deter clients, depending on your industry.


Ensure to examine paint samples in various lighting conditions to see exactly how they interact with the environment and your message.

Neglecting Upkeep Requirements



Picking the ideal outside paint color isn't nearly visual appeals or brand placement; it likewise entails thinking about maintenance. When you choose a shade, think of how it will certainly hold up over time and what upkeep it'll require. Some tones show dust and grime greater than others, requiring regular cleaning or repainting. As an example, lighter shades might require regular cleaning to keep them looking fresh, while darker shades might discolor quicker under harsh sunlight.

Don't forget to examine the paint's resilience against the components. If you're in a region with extreme weather condition, select a shade and finish that stands up to the conditions. Specific colors can also show warm or absorb it, influencing your structure's energy efficiency and long life.

Additionally, consider just how commonly you want to invest money and time into maintenance. If you prefer a low-maintenance alternative, select a shade that's less prone to fading or discoloration.

Inevitably, making an enlightened choice regarding paint shades indicates factoring in the long-lasting maintenance, guaranteeing your service looks its finest without consistent treatment. Keep these upkeep needs in mind to stay clear of costly repairs and guarantee your outside continues to be attractive gradually.

Skipping Examination Examples



While it could seem alluring to skip the test samples when choosing exterior paint colors, doing so can result in unanticipated outcomes. You may assume you've chosen the best color based upon a little swatch or a digital sneak peek, yet shades can look substantially various depending on lights and environments.

What looks like a lively blue in the shop could appear dull or washed out on your building. To prevent this blunder, always test your chosen colors on the real surface area. Acquisition little example pots and apply patches on various areas of your exterior.

Observe just how the color changes throughout the day as the light shifts. This easy step can save you from a pricey repaint later. Furthermore, take into consideration the colors of surrounding buildings and landscape design. These components can affect exactly how your shade option searches in the wider context.

Do not forget to bear in mind of the coating-- matte, satin, or shiny-- because it additionally influences the overall appearance. Spending time in screening examples ensures you're not only completely satisfied with the shade yet additionally positive it enhances your business's visual allure.
